About

The Harringay Warehouse District is a former industrial area in Haringey, known for its repurposed warehouses and creative spaces. The area has become a hub for artists, musicians, and small businesses, with many warehouses converted into studios, workshops, and live music venues. Its industrial character remains visible, with brick buildings and railway arches defining the streetscape. The district attracts a mix of creative professionals and nightlife visitors, contributing to its evolving identity.

Nearby, the Vartry area is a quieter residential neighborhood, featuring Victorian and Edwardian terraced houses. The area is close to Finsbury Park and Green Lanes, offering easy access to transport links and local amenities. Vartry has a community-focused atmosphere, with small parks and independent shops adding to its appeal. The contrast between the industrial energy of the Warehouse District and the residential calm of Vartry reflects Haringey's varied character.

Area overview

On average Harringay Warehouse District & Vartry has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 107 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 32.9%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income of residents in Harringay Warehouse District & Vartry is £48,400 per year. There are 1 schools in Harringay Warehouse District & Vartry: 1 primary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good) and 0 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good). On average most houses in area has average public transport connectivity.
